Excel Downloads
Forum

Précédent   Excel Downloads Forums > Excel > Forum Excel


Réponse
 
LinkBack Outils de la discussion
Vieux 24/07/2007, 08h09   #1 (permalink)
XLDnaute Occasionel
 
Date d'inscription: juin 2007
Messages: 156
Talking Controle d'une checkbox dans un autre USF

Bonjour le forum !!!
Qq'un pourrait me dire si il est possible de controler a partir d'un USF la visiblite d'une checkbox et d'un label present dans un autre USF...
Pour etre plus clair j'ai un checkbox et un label present dans un USF, a l'action sur le checkbox, un autre USF apparait !!! sur ce dernier deux bouton un valider et un annuler... lorsque on valide je voudrais que le label et le ckb du premier USF disparaissent... et lorsqu'on annule, le label et le ckb reste mais le checkbox se decoche...
Qq'un peut m'aider ?
Merci a plus tard !!!

@lex
titilex est déconnecté   Réponse avec citation
ANNONCES
Vieux 24/07/2007, 08h44   #2 (permalink)
XLDnaute Barbatruc
 
Avatar de Pierrot93
 
Date d'inscription: août 2006
Version Excel : Excel 2003 (PC)
Messages: 4 750
Par défaut Re : Controle d'une checkbox dans un autre USF

Bonjour Titilex

cela ne doit pas poser de problème, si ton 1er USF, n'est pas déchargé, à partir du code des boutons du 2ème USF, tu peux intervenir sur les objets du 1er, en spécifiant le nom de l'USF conteneur. Si tu rencontres des difficultés, mets petit fichier exemple en pièce jointe.

bonne journée
@+
__________________
Pierrot

On se trouve toujours suffisamment intelligent, vu que c'est avec ce que l'on a qu'on juge !!!
Pierrot93 est déconnecté   Réponse avec citation
Vieux 24/07/2007, 09h42   #3 (permalink)
XLDnaute Occasionel
 
Date d'inscription: juin 2007
Messages: 156
Talking Re : Controle d'une checkbox dans un autre USF

Salut Pierrot !!!

Bon ben voila j'ai mis un fichier en piece jointe !!!
J'explique un peu le fonctionnement !!!
Quand on clic sur le bouton en haut de la page, on a un usf qui s'ouvre, on choisit cree... Un nouvelle USF apparait avec des champs a renseigner... j'ai une checkbox qui permet de rajouter une nouvelle personne si elle n'est pas dans la liste... alors un USf apparait et permet de rajouté un nom... il va directement sur la feuille "données" s'incrementer dans la liste de nom...Sur l'USf de rajout de nom il y a valider et annuler... Si on clic sur annuler je voudrais que la fenetre des entrées réapparaissent mais avec le checkbox decoché et si on clic sur valider je voudrais que le checkbox et le label a cote disparaissent...
Tu peut jeter un coup d'oeil ou qq'un si il a un peu de temps a perdre avec mon probleme...
Ensuite j'ai un autre soucis, c'est que la liste ne se met pas jour dynamiquement...
Fichiers attachés
Type de fichier : zip Ex-interfaceV1.zip (28,2 Ko, 4 affichages)
titilex est déconnecté   Réponse avec citation
Vieux 24/07/2007, 10h00   #4 (permalink)
XLDnaute Barbatruc
 
Avatar de Pierrot93
 
Date d'inscription: août 2006
Version Excel : Excel 2003 (PC)
Messages: 4 750
Par défaut Re : Controle d'une checkbox dans un autre USF

Re

je modifierais peut être les codes de tes boutons comme suit :

Code:
Private Sub CommandButton1_Click()
USF_MODIF.CheckBox1.Visible = False
USF_MODIF.Label1.Visible = False
USF_NOM.Hide
USF_ENTREE.Show
' Ecrit la nouvelle entrée sur la feuil2 à la suite des entrées existante
derlig = Sheets("Données").Range("A65536").End(xlUp).Row
Sheets("Données").Range("A" & derlig + 1).Value = UCase(TextBox1.Text)
Dim valeur As String, Celldest As Range, Ligne As String
Ligne = Sheets("Données").Range("A65536").End(xlUp).Row
Sheets("Données").Select
Range("A2", "A" & Ligne).Select
Selection.Sort Key1:=Range("A2"), Order1:=xlAscending
End Sub
Private Sub CommandButton2_Click()
USF_MODIF.CheckBox1.Value = False
Unload USF_NOM
USF_ENTREE.Show
USF_ENTREE.CheckBox1.Value = False
End Sub
par contre j'ai pas trouvé l'instruction qui permet de charger l'USF NOM... sans doute mal cherché...

attention, l'usf "modif" sur lequel je masque les boutons ne doit pas être déchargé. Ne pas utiliser la commande "unload" mais plutôt "Hide".

@+
__________________
Pierrot

On se trouve toujours suffisamment intelligent, vu que c'est avec ce que l'on a qu'on juge !!!
Pierrot93 est déconnecté   Réponse avec citation
Vieux 24/07/2007, 10h44   #5 (permalink)
XLDnaute Occasionel
 
Date d'inscription: juin 2007
Messages: 156
Par défaut Re : Controle d'une checkbox dans un autre USF

Merci Pierrot de prendre un peu de temps pour jeter un coup d'oeil sur mon probleme !!!
Je vais mettre ce code pour voir ce que ca donne, en revanche l'Usf modif n'as rien avoir pour le moment...
Je jete un coup d'oeil et je reviens...

@lex
titilex est déconnecté   Réponse avec citation
Vieux 24/07/2007, 10h48   #6 (permalink)
XLDnaute Barbatruc
 
Avatar de Pierrot93
 
Date d'inscription: août 2006
Version Excel : Excel 2003 (PC)
Messages: 4 750
Par défaut Re : Controle d'une checkbox dans un autre USF

re

Aarf, c'est bien ce qu'il me semblais, mais en modifiant le nom de l'USF tu devrais pouvoir t'en sortir.

@+
__________________
Pierrot

On se trouve toujours suffisamment intelligent, vu que c'est avec ce que l'on a qu'on juge !!!
Pierrot93 est déconnecté   Réponse avec citation
Vieux 24/07/2007, 10h49   #7 (permalink)
XLDnaute Occasionel
 
Date d'inscription: juin 2007
Messages: 156
Par défaut Re : Controle d'une checkbox dans un autre USF

Re Pierrot

Bon en fait l'USF_NOM est appelé par la valeur du checkbox present sur l'USF_ENTREE.
Voila l'ordre,
- USF_ENTREE apparait, dans le cas ou le nom qu'on veut n'est pas dans la liste, on clic sur le checkbox,
- l'USF_NOM apparait maintenant et l'USF_ENTREE disparait
- dans la textbox de l'USF_NOM on ecrit son nom, si on clic sur valider, le nom s'increment sur la liste de la deuxieme page, et la le checkbox de USF_ENTREE + le label disparaissent de l'USF_ENTREE
- Si on clic sur annuler dans l'USF_NOM, la checkbox se decoche...
...
Je sais pas si j'ai ete plus clair sur mes explications ?
titilex est déconnecté   Réponse avec citation
Vieux 24/07/2007, 10h52   #8 (permalink)
XLDnaute Barbatruc
 
Avatar de Pierrot93
 
Date d'inscription: août 2006
Version Excel : Excel 2003 (PC)
Messages: 4 750
Par défaut Re : Controle d'une checkbox dans un autre USF

re

on a du se croiser, regarde mon post précédent, si problème reviens, mais en changeant le nom du USF ca devrait marcher...
__________________
Pierrot

On se trouve toujours suffisamment intelligent, vu que c'est avec ce que l'on a qu'on juge !!!
Pierrot93 est déconnecté   Réponse avec citation
Vieux 24/07/2007, 10h55   #9 (permalink)
XLDnaute Occasionel
 
Date d'inscription: juin 2007
Messages: 156
Par défaut Re : Controle d'une checkbox dans un autre USF

Je pige pas bien le coup de changer le nom de l'USF, qu'est ce que cela va changer tu pense qu'il y a qq chose qui se passe avec le nom de l'USF ?
titilex est déconnecté   Réponse avec citation
Vieux 24/07/2007, 11h04   #10 (permalink)
XLDnaute Barbatruc
 
Avatar de Pierrot93
 
Date d'inscription: août 2006
Version Excel : Excel 2003 (PC)
Messages: 4 750
Par défaut Re : Controle d'une checkbox dans un autre USF

Re

non, changer le nom dans la synthaxe, ci dessous :

Code:
USF_MODIF.CheckBox1.Visible = False
là tu agis à partir de ton USF_NOM sur ton USF_MODIF, si ta checkbox est sur ton USF_ENTREE, tu modifies la ligne de code comme ci dessous :

Code:
USF_ENTREE.CheckBox1.Visible = False
__________________
Pierrot

On se trouve toujours suffisamment intelligent, vu que c'est avec ce que l'on a qu'on juge !!!
Pierrot93 est déconnecté   Réponse avec citation
Vieux 24/07/2007, 11h15   #11 (permalink)
XLDnaute Occasionel
 
Date d'inscription: juin 2007
Messages: 156
Par défaut Re : Controle d'une checkbox dans un autre USF

Ohhh puré la bourde...
J'avais capté ca !!! C'est ce qu'on appel (l'ortographe en moins) une faute "detour de riz"... ...
Je vais bidouiller un peu tout ca voir si ca donne qq'chose...
Merci pierrot pour ton aide !!!
A plus tard

@lex
titilex est déconnecté   Réponse avec citation
Vieux 24/07/2007, 11h37   #12 (permalink)
XLDnaute Barbatruc
 
Avatar de Pierrot93
 
Date d'inscription: août 2006
Version Excel : Excel 2003 (PC)
Messages: 4 750
Par défaut Re : Controle d'une checkbox dans un autre USF

Re Titilex

ton fichier en retour, nom USF corrigé + mise à jour de la liste.

@+
Fichiers attachés
Type de fichier : zip Ex-interfaceV1.zip (21,8 Ko, 13 affichages)
__________________
Pierrot

On se trouve toujours suffisamment intelligent, vu que c'est avec ce que l'on a qu'on juge !!!
Pierrot93 est déconnecté   Réponse avec citation
Vieux 24/07/2007, 12h09   #13 (permalink)
XLDnaute Occasionel
 
Date d'inscription: juin 2007
Messages: 156
Talking Re : Controle d'une checkbox dans un autre USF

Ben ecoute Pierrot la tu m'a dépatouillé de qq heures de bidouille !!!
Merci bcp de ton aide !!! je vais pouvoir adapter tout ca à mon cas de figure !!! et je vais surtout retenir tout le code pour pouvoir l'analyser !!!
Merci encore de ton aide...

A bientot !!!

Le jour ou je serais aussi fort en Vba je pourrais aider aussi les autres... Pour le moment je suis encore qu'un petit scarabée !!!
titilex est déconnecté   Réponse avec citation
ANNONCES
Réponse

Liens sociaux

Outils de la discussion

Règles de messages
Vous ne pouvez pas créer de nouvelles discussions
Vous ne pouvez pas envoyer des réponses
Vous ne pouvez pas envoyer des pièces jointes
Vous ne pouvez pas modifier vos messages

Les balises BB sont activées : oui
Les smileys sont activés : oui
La balise [IMG] est activée : oui
Le code HTML peut être employé : non
Trackbacks are oui
Pingbacks are oui
Refbacks are oui

Discussions similaires
Discussion Auteur Forum Réponses Dernier message
recherche d'une date dans une BDD et copie dans une autre feuille fourmi4x Forum Excel 5 02/05/2007 12h48
application d'une formule en consequence d'une presence dans une autre smartbis Forum Excel 8 21/04/2007 20h01
Copier le commentaire dans une autre cellule d'une autre feuille Celeda Forum Excel 10 01/09/2006 08h50
copie de contrôle (checkbox) guillaume07 Forum Excel 2 16/03/2006 13h09
recuper données d'une listbox dans une autre textbox sur une autre feuille jp Forum Excel Downloads - Archives 0 09/05/2003 18h28


Fuseau horaire GMT +2. Il est actuellement 18h52.


(C) 2006 Excel Downloads